Administrator Passwort in der Nextcloud verlangt (bspw. für externe Speicher)

Ich möchte meiner Nextcloud Externen Speicher zuweisen über die App Externer Speicher.

Leider funktioniert dies nicht da ich um das hinzuzufügen ein Passwort eingeben muss.

Keines der Passwörter welche ich habe, das Passwort meines Benutzers über das SSO noch das SSO Passwort des Admins oder mein Rootpasswort vom Server.

Wie bekomme ich das funktionsfähig?

Das sollte schon das Administrator Passwort sein.
Kann im schlimmsten Fall noch das Passwort von der Libre Workspace Installation, was Du damals vergeben hast sein.
Ich schaue mir mal das bei den neuen SSO Instanzen an.

Ok, dann warte ich solange bzw. schaue ob das Passwort was ich als Administrator angegeben habe funktioniert.

Ich habe das export AUTH_LDAP_BIND_PASSWORD=“deinpassworthier” aus folgender Datei genommen

/usr/share/linux-arbeitsplatz/cfg

Leider hat dies nicht funktioniert.

Edit: Habe auch ein App Passwort zum test erstellt leider ging dies auch nicht.

Habe mir das mal genauer angesehen und es scheint so, also ob das einfach nicht vorgesehen ist. (Admin actions require password · Issue #54 · pulsejet/nextcloud-oidc-login · GitHub)
Da das schon 4 Jahre offen ist sieht das wohl so aus, als ob ich mich mal da selber ransetzen muss.

Das ist der aktuelle Workaround:

sudo -u www-data /var/www/nextcloud/occ app:disable oidc_login
  • Dann als Administrator ganz normal bei der Nextcloud anmelden und die Änderungen vornehmen
  • Sollte das nicht funktionieren (evtl. bei ganz “alten” Instanzen, kann man einen neuen lokalen Nextcloud Admin erstellen:)
sudo -u www-data /var/www/nextcloud/occ user:add mylocalnextcloudadmin
sudo -u www-data php /var/www/nextcloud/occ group:adduser admin mylocalnextcloudadmin
  • Nach den Änderungen wie bsw. hier das Konfigurieren des externen Speichers kann man das SSO wieder aktivieren:
sudo -u www-data /var/www/nextcloud/occ app:enable oidc_login

So vielen Dank für die schnelle Hilfe. Es hat einwandfrei funktioniert. Ja es ist schade das ein Issue seit 4 Jahren offen steht und noch nichts dran gemacht wurde.

1 „Gefällt mir“